#218d88 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#218d88 is composed of 12.9% red, 55.3%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.5%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 177.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 34.1%. #218d88 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ffff with #001b11.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#218d88 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#218d88 has RGB values of R:33, G:141,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 2198920.

Shades and Tints of #218d88
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e0d is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.
